What is an Oxymel?

The word oxymel comes from the ancient Greek oxymeli (α½€ξύμελι), meaning “acid and honey.” This simple yet powerful remedy dates back to Hippocrates, who praised its ability to cleanse the body, aid digestion, and support overall health.

 

At its core, an oxymel is a herbal extraction method that balances the sharpness of vinegar with the soothing sweetness of honey. The vinegar draws out and preserves the medicinal compounds of herbs, while honey enhances both the flavour and therapeutic effects. The result is a potent, syrup-like remedy that is easy to take and a favourite among herbalists for generations.

 

Why Oxymels for Immunity?

  • Apple cider vinegar 
  • Apple cider vinegar does more than just preserve herbs—it actively supports immune health. It helps break down mucus, making it easier to clear congestion, while its antimicrobial properties help fight off infections. ACV also improves digestion by boosting stomach acid and enhancing nutrient absorption, which is key for a strong immune system.
  • Despite its acidity, apple cider vinegar has an alkalising effect in the body, helping to reduce inflammation and support overall resilience. Rich in antioxidants, it protects cells from damage while also balancing blood sugar levels—helping to prevent energy crashes that can leave the body more susceptible to illness.
  • As a bonus, ACV supports lymphatic drainage, assisting the body in flushing out toxins and keeping the immune system functioning optimally. All of these qualities make it the ideal foundation for a potent, immune-boosting oxymel.

 

  • Raw honey
  • Raw honey isn’t just for sweetness—it’s a powerhouse of immune support. Naturally antimicrobial and antibacterial, it helps fight off infections while soothing the throat and respiratory system. Its anti-inflammatory properties ease irritation, while antioxidants help combat oxidative stress and support overall immunity.
  • Unlike processed honey, raw honey contains enzymes, probiotics, and beneficial compounds that promote gut health—one of the key players in a strong immune system. It also acts as a natural preservative, extending the shelf life of herbal remedies while enhancing their medicinal properties.
  • With its ability to coat and soothe, raw honey makes oxymels more palatable, especially for children, while also amplifying their healing effects. It’s the perfect partner to apple cider vinegar, working together to nourish and protect the body.

 

  • Herbs 
  • Herbs are the heart of an oxymel, each bringing unique properties to strengthen and support the immune system. Many, like elderberry and echinacea, are antiviral and help the body fight infections more effectively. Others, such as garlic and thyme, have powerful antimicrobial properties that target bacteria and viruses while also supporting respiratory health.
  • Warming herbs like ginger and turmeric reduce inflammation, improve circulation, and help break down mucus, making them ideal for colds and congestion. Nutrient-rich herbs like rosehips provide a natural boost of vitamin C, enhancing the body’s defences against seasonal illness.
  • Beyond immunity, adaptogenic and soothing herbs like lemon balm and chamomile can help regulate stress—a crucial factor in maintaining overall health. By infusing these herbs into an oxymel, their benefits are extracted, preserved, and made easy to incorporate into daily routines, creating a natural remedy that supports the whole family through the cooler months.

 

Some Herb Options for an Immunity-Boosting Oxymel

 

  • Elderberry – Antiviral and rich in antioxidants to help ward off colds and flu.
  • Garlic – A powerhouse antimicrobial, antibacterial, and antiviral herb.
  • Ginger – Warming, anti-inflammatory, and helps break down mucus.
  • Thyme – Respiratory-supporting, antibacterial, and great for coughs.
  • Echinacea – Supports immune response and reduces severity of infections.
  • Rosehips – High in vitamin C, strengthens immune defences.
  • Turmeric – Anti-inflammatory, supports the immune system and gut health.

 

How to Make an Immunity-Boosting Oxymel

  1. Gather your ingredients: Choose one or a mix of the herbs above. Dried or fresh both work.
  2. Fill a jar halfway with herbs (chopped if fresh, or loosely packed if dried).
  3. Pour raw apple cider vinegar over the herbs until they are completely submerged.
  4. Top up with raw honey (typically a 1:3 ratio of honey to vinegar, but you can adjust for taste).
  5. Cover with a non-metal lid (vinegar reacts with metal), or place a piece of baking paper underneath lid as a barrier.
  6. Let it infuse for 2–6 weeks, shaking the jar occasionally.
  7. Strain and bottle – Store in a cool, dark place.

How to Use It

 

  • Take 1–2 teaspoons daily as a preventative, straight off the spoon.
  • Stir into warm (not hot) water or juice.
  • Drizzle over salads or roasted vegetables.
  • Mix into a tonic with warm water, lemon, and ginger.

 

Oxymels for Kids

 

For little ones, keep the blend gentler with:

 

  • A little more honey to balance the acidity.
  • Kid-friendly herbs like chamomile, lemon balm, and elderberry.
  • Diluting in warm water or juice before giving.
